Exploring Solar Mounting Brackets: The Key to Efficient Solar Panel Installation
Solar mounting brackets are vital components in the installation of solar panel systems. These brackets serve as the foundation for securely mounting solar panels to various surfaces, including rooftops and ground installations. Understanding the significance and functionality of solar mounting brackets is essential for both residential and commercial solar projects.
One of the primary functions of solar mounting brackets is to ensure that solar panels are positioned at the optimal angle to capture sunlight. The angle of installation can significantly influence the amount of solar energy harvested. By using adjustable mounting brackets, installers can fine-tune the panel orientation based on the geographic location and seasonal sun trajectory, maximizing energy production.
In addition to optimizing angle, solar mounting brackets also provide structural integrity. They are designed to withstand various environmental conditions, including heavy winds, snow loads, and seismic activity. A robust mounting system ensures that the solar panels remain securely attached, preventing damage and maintaining efficiency over time. Consequently, selecting the right type of solar mounting bracket is crucial for both performance and safety.
There are several types of solar mounting brackets available, each tailored for different applications. Roof-mounted brackets are typically used for residential installations, allowing panels to be securely attached to the roof structure. Ground-mounted systems, on the other hand, may include fixed or tracking mounts that follow the sun's path throughout the day, optimizing energy capture. Understanding the specific needs of the installation site is key to choosing the appropriate type of mounting bracket.
